将用户数据从django迁移到drupal 7

将用户数据从django迁移到drupal 7,django,drupal-7,Django,Drupal 7,有没有办法将用户数据从django迁移到drupal-7。我的老django网站中有800个用户,我想将这些用户迁移到drupal-7。请建议一些技巧或教程。我在谷歌上搜索了很多,但找不到任何直接的解决办法 感谢您的帮助和建议。我相信没有专门针对这一点的模块。但是,可以帮助您进行迁移。它要求您为迁移创建一些代码。但是,只有当您的用户有很多自定义字段时,才有必要这样做 如果他们是简单用户(用户名/电子邮件/密码),您只需要编写一个简单的脚本来创建用户。在这种情况下,您可以使用从外部脚本启动它,并使

有没有办法将用户数据从django迁移到drupal-7。我的老django网站中有800个用户,我想将这些用户迁移到drupal-7。请建议一些技巧或教程。我在谷歌上搜索了很多,但找不到任何直接的解决办法


感谢您的帮助和建议。

我相信没有专门针对这一点的模块。但是,可以帮助您进行迁移。它要求您为迁移创建一些代码。但是,只有当您的用户有很多自定义字段时,才有必要这样做

如果他们是简单用户(用户名/电子邮件/密码),您只需要编写一个简单的脚本来创建用户。在这种情况下,您可以使用从外部脚本启动它,并使用创建用户

<?php
define('DRUPAL_ROOT', '/path/to/drupal');
require_once DRUPAL_ROOT . '/includes/bootstrap.inc';
drupal_boostrap(DRUPAL_BOOTSTRAP_FULL);

//set up the user fields
$fields = array(
   'name' => 'user_name',
   'mail' => 'user_name@example.com',
   'pass' => $password,
   'status' => 1,
   'init' => 'email address',
   'roles' => array(
     DRUPAL_AUTHENTICATED_RID => 'authenticated user',
   ),
);

//the first parameter is left blank so a new user is created
$account = user_save('', $fields);

我怀疑是否有现成的工具可用于此。您可以轻松地使用django命令从django的users表中读取数据并写入drupal数据库。我建议您在这里学习并描述每个django和drupal中为每个用户存储的数据。如果您这样做,您将能够创建一个自定义解决方案来迁移重要的内容。